    Senior Digital Producer

    Department: Production & Training
    Reports to: Head of Production and Training
    Start Date:  Immediate
    Type of Contract: Fixed Term
    Duration of Contract: 6 months (with possibility of extension)

    Job Purpose

    • The Senior Digital Producer will use her/his strong editorial expertise, extensive digital programme production experience, and ability to build the skills and capacity of others to oversee our digital outputs, including videos, images, postings and other multimedia materials. This is a senior role within the Production & Training Department.

    Main Duties

    • Take day-do-day responsibility for the effective implementation of BBC Media Action’s digital strategy.
    • Working with the Head of Production & Training, ensure systems are in place to support all aspects of the design and delivery of digital content, from concept inception to post-production. Ensure that deadlines, budgets, and project objectives are met and adhered to.
    • Supervise the Digital team as they pitch, write, report, record and edit original BBC Media Action content geared toward social media, TV and other digital audiences, including the creation of original video and multimedia content.
    • Lead on ensuring that BBC Media Action’s digital outputs are as creative and impactful as possible to help us remain a leader in a dynamic and evolving media market.
    • Build the editorial skills of other members of the Digital team to allow them to take on progressively greater roles in making editorial decisions.
    • Build the creative and production skills of other members of the Digital team to allow them to take on progressively greater content and creative decisions.
    • Lead the Digital team in engaging and interacting with our communities across social platforms.
    • Ensure that all content or language published on BBC Media Action Digital platforms adhere to BBC Editorial Guidelines.
    • Prioritise relevant content creation and platform management against identified goals, knowing which platforms and tasks are more important to different audiences within the scope of BBC Media Action’s digital strategy.
    • Work with other Production & Training team members to ensure that BBC Media Action’s digital, radio and TV content complements each other for maximum reach and audience impact.
    • Lead the Digital team as they analyse social media metrics to gain insight into the behaviour of our social media communities, distribution of content across the web, and emerging digital trends.
    • Contribute to the evolution of BBC Media Action’s digital strategy by providing innovative content ideas and concrete insights into content performance.

    Key competencies
    The following competencies (behaviours and characteristics) have been identified as key to success in the job. Successful candidates are expected to demonstrate these competencies:

    • Editorial Judgement - Demonstrates balanced and objective judgement based on a thorough understanding of editorial guidelines, target audience, programme and department objectives. Makes the right editorial decisions, taking account of conflicting views where necessary.
    • Decision Making - Is ready and able to take the initiative, originate action and be responsible for the consequences of the decision made.
    • Planning and Organisation - Is able to think ahead in order to establish an efficient and appropriate course of action for self and Others. Prioritises and plans activities taking into account all the relevant issues and factors such as deadlines, staffing and resources requirements.
    • Managing relationships and team working - Able to build and maintain effective working relationships with a range of people. Works co-operatively with others to be part of a team, as opposed working separately or competitively.
    • Developing Others - Able to recognise potential (managerial, professional, artistic or otherwise) and is willing to foster the development of that potential. Creates a climate in which potential can be realized.
    • Resilience - Can maintain personal effectiveness by managing own emotions in the lace of pressure, setbacks or when dealing with provocative situations, Can demonstrate an approach to work that is characterised by commitment, motivation and energy.
    • Influencing and Persuading - Ability to present sound and well-reasoned arguments to convince others. Can draw from a range of strategies to persuade people in a way that results in agreement or behaviour change.
